HB 26-1182
signedSunset Veterinary Pharmaceutical Advisory Committee
Plain-English Summary
AI-generatedHouse Bill 26-1182, which has been signed into law, gets rid of the Veterinary Pharmaceutical Advisory Committee. This committee was a group that advised on issues related to veterinary drugs in Colorado. The bill was recommended by the Department of Regulatory Agencies based on their review process known as the "sunset" review, which evaluates the need for certain advisory groups and programs. Since the bill has been signed, the committee will no longer exist, meaning it won't be advising or making recommendations about veterinary pharmaceutical issues anymore.
Official Summary
The act repeals the veterinary pharmaceutical advisory committee as recommended in the department of regulatory agencies' 2025 sunset report.(Note: This summary applies to this bill as enacted.)
